Learn about CVE-2018-7484, a vulnerability in PureVPN up to version 5.19.4.0 for Windows, allowing privilege escalation through DLL hijacking. Find out how to mitigate this security risk.
A vulnerability was identified in PureVPN up to version 5.19.4.0 for Windows, allowing privilege escalation through DLL hijacking.
Understanding CVE-2018-7484
What is CVE-2018-7484?
An issue in PureVPN up to version 5.19.4.0 for Windows grants excessive permissions and uses insecure loading of dynamic-link libraries, potentially leading to privilege escalation.
The Impact of CVE-2018-7484
The vulnerability could allow malicious actors to escalate privileges on affected systems, compromising their security.
Technical Details of CVE-2018-7484
Vulnerability Description
During installation, PureVPN assigns Full Control permission to the Everyone group for the installation directory, and the PureVPNService.exe service loads dynamic-link libraries using insecure relative paths.
Affected Systems and Versions
Exploitation Mechanism
The vulnerability arises from the insecure permission assignment and library loading, enabling attackers to exploit DLL hijacking for privilege escalation.
Mitigation and Prevention
Immediate Steps to Take
Long-Term Security Practices
Patching and Updates
Ensure that all software, including PureVPN, is regularly updated to mitigate known vulnerabilities.